Mother Of MS13 Victim Honored By Trump Tragically Killed While Attending Daughter’s Memorial

BRENTWOOD, NY. (THECOUNT) — Evelyn Rodriguez, of Long Island, NY, has been identified as the woman struck and killed by a vehicle while attending her daughter, Kayla Cuevas‘, memorial.

Rodriguez, who was recognized by President Donald Trump at the State of the Union after her daughter was killed by MS-13 gang members, was tragically struck and killed by a car, said Rep. Peter King.

Rep. Peter King said Evelyn Rodriguez of Long Island was hit Friday evening, about an hour before a planned memorial for her daughter, Kayla Cuevas, in Brentwood. source

A spokeswoman for the Suffolk County Police Department did not immediately provide details about the crash.

Cuevas and her 15-year-old friend, Nisa Mickens, were killed in the Long Island neighborhood that has become the epicenter in the fight against MS-13 violence.
